a{text-decoration:none;}
a:link{color:#0f3f9f; text-decoration:none;}
a:hover{color:#026735; text-decoration:none;}
a:visited{color:#0f3f9f; text-decoration:none;}
a:active{color:#0f3f9f; text-decoration:none;}

a.nav:link{text-decoration:none; color:#00ff00;}
a.nav:visited{text-decoration:none; color:#00ff00;}
a.nav:hover{text-decoration:none; color:#ff6802;}
a.nav:active{text-decoration:none; color:#ff6802;}


body
{
color:#000000;
background-color:#afafaf;
/* margin:0px; */
FONT-FAMILY: Verdana, Arial, Helvetica, Sans-serif; 
}


form
{
margin:0px;
}


.outer
{
width:770px;
margin:0px auto 0px auto;
background-color:#ffffff;
background:url(assets/nigel-risner-background-v2.gif) repeat-y;
}


.back2
{
width:770px;
background:url(assets/nigel-risner-ps-swoosh-combined.gif) bottom right no-repeat;
}


.bottomrow
{
clear:both;
width:770px;
height:20px;
/* background:#212421; */
background:url(assets/nigel-risner-footer.gif);
}


.bottom-right-text
{
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:8pt;
text-align:right;
color:#ffffff;
float:left;
width:500px;
/* padding:3px 0px; */
}


.bottom-left-text
{
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:8pt;
text-align:left;
color:#ffffff;
float:left;
width:270px;
/* padding:3px 0px; */
}

.quote-box
{
background:url(assets/nigel-risner-sc-box-stretchy.gif) repeat-y;
padding:10px 15px;
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:7pt;
text-align:justify;
color:#ffffff;
}

.quote-name
{
color:#ff6500;
font-weight:bold;
}

.quote-job
{
color:#f78218;
font-weight:bold;
}

.ct
{
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:8pt;
text-align:left;
color:#333333;
padding:0px 10px 0px 10px;
}

.ctc
{
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:8pt;
text-align:center;
color:#333333;
/* padding:0px 10px 0px 10px; */
}

.tct
{
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:10pt;
text-align:left;
font-weight:bold;
color:#FF6600;
padding:0px 10px 0px 10px;
}

.main-content
{
padding:10px;
font-size:.7em;
}

.reference
{
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:12pt;
text-align:left;
font-weight:bold;
border-style:solid;
border-width:1px 2px 1px 1px;
border-color:#654321;
background-color:#123456;
line-height:120%;
padding:5px 5px 5px 5px;
}

.login-field
{
border:solid #b5b2b5 1px; background:#212421; color:#ffffff; width:127px;
}

.prod
{
font-size:1em;
}

.prod2
{

}

A:link
{
COLOR: #ff6500;
TEXT-DECORATION: none;
}

A:visited
{
COLOR: #ff6500;
TEXT-DECORATION: none;
}

A:hover
{
COLOR: #f78218;
TEXT-DECORATION: none;
}

A:active
{
COLOR: #f78218;
TEXT-DECORATION: none;
}

H1
{
font-size:1.2em;
}

H2
{
font-size:1.1em;
}

H3
{
font-size:1em;
}

HR
{
COLOR: #DDDDDD;
HEIGHT: 1px;
}

body
{
background-color:#afafaf;
margin:0px;
}


.HeadBox 
{
BACKGROUND-COLOR: #FFFBD3;
}

.HeadText 
{
FONT-WEIGHT: bold;
}

.HeadLine
{
BACKGROUND-COLOR: #FFD44C;
}

.VertMenuBox
{
background:url(assets/nigel-risner-sc-box-stretchy.gif) repeat-y;
}

.VertMenuBorder
{
BACKGROUND-COLOR:#ffffff;
}

.VertMenuTitle
{
BACKGROUND-COLOR: #FF8600;
COLOR: #330000;
FONT-WEIGHT: bold;
}

.VertMenuItems
{
COLOR: #ffffff;
TEXT-DECORATION: none;
}


.minicart
{
COLOR: #ffffff;
TEXT-DECORATION: none;
font-size:.7em;
}

.VertMenuItems:link
{
COLOR: #ffffff;
TEXT-DECORATION: none;
}

.VertMenuItems:visited
{
COLOR: #ffffff;
TEXT-DECORATION: none;
}

.VertMenuItems:hover
{
COLOR: #ff6500;
TEXT-DECORATION: none;
}

.VertMenuItems:active
 {
COLOR: #ff6500;
TEXT-DECORATION: none;
}

.VertMenuHr
{
COLOR: #ffffff;
}

.CategoriesList
{
line-height:150%;
text-align:right;
}

.DialogBox
{
BACKGROUND-COLOR: #ffffff;
font-size:.7em;
}

.DialogBorder
{
BACKGROUND-COLOR: transparent;
}

.DialogTitle
{
COLOR: #ff6500;
FONT-WEIGHT: bold;
font-size:.8em;
}

.NumberOfArticles
{
COLOR: #000000;
FONT-WEIGHT: bold;
}

.TopLabel
{
COLOR: #000000;
FONT-WEIGHT: bold;
FONT-SIZE: 12px;
}

.Text
{
COLOR: #000000;
}

.DecorTr
{
COLOR: #388493;
}

.AdminSmallMessage
{
COLOR: #FF3300;
}

.AdminTitle
{
COLOR: #FF3300;
FONT-WEIGHT: bold;
}

.Line
{
BACKGROUND-COLOR: #FF6600;
}

.ProductTitle
{
COLOR: #000000;
FONT-WEIGHT: bold;
}

.ProductTitleHidden
{
COLOR: #666666;
FONT-WEIGHT: bold;
}

.ProductDetailsTitle
{
COLOR: #FF3300;
FONT-WEIGHT: bold;
font-size:.8em;
}

.ProductDetails
{
COLOR: #000000;
font-size:.8em;
}

.ProductPriceTitle
{
COLOR: #000000;
FONT-WEIGHT: bold;
font-size:.8em;
}

.ProductPriceConverting
{
COLOR: #000000;
FONT-WEIGHT: bold;
}

.ProductPrice
{
COLOR: #FF3300;
FONT-WEIGHT: bold;
}

.ProductPriceSmall
{
COLOR: #FF3300;
FONT-WEIGHT: bold;
}

.MarketPrice
{
FONT-FAMILY: verdana;
font-size:.8em;
}

.ItemsList
{
COLOR: #330000;
FONT-WEIGHT: bold;
}

#Disabled
{
COLOR: #909090;
}

.NavigationPath
{
COLOR: #ff6500;
FONT-WEIGHT: bold;
TEXT-DECORATION: none;
}

.NavigationPath:link
{
COLOR: #ff6500;
FONT-WEIGHT: bold;
TEXT-DECORATION: none;
}

.NavigationPath:visited
{
COLOR: #ff6500;
FONT-WEIGHT: bold;
TEXT-DECORATION: none;
}

.NavigationPath:hover
{
COLOR: #f78218;
FONT-WEIGHT: bold;
TEXT-DECORATION: none;
}

.NavigationPath:active
{
COLOR: #f78218;
FONT-WEIGHT: bold;
TEXT-DECORATION: none;
}

.FormButton
{
COLOR: #330000;
FONT-WEIGHT: bold; 
}

.Button
{                                 
FONT-FAMILY: verdana;
BACKGROUND: URL(images/butbg.gif);
BACKGROUND-COLOR: #FF8600;
COLOR: #FFFFFF;
FONT-WEIGHT: bold;
TEXT-DECORATION: none;
font-size:.8em;
}

.CustomerMessage
{
COLOR: #FF3300;
FONT-WEIGHT: bold; 
}

.ErrorMessage
{
COLOR: #FF3300;
FONT-WEIGHT: bold; 
}

.Star
{
COLOR: #FF0000;
}

.HighLight
{
BACKGROUND-COLOR: #FFFFCC;
}

.SaveMoneyLabel
{
COLOR: #FFFFFF;
FONT-WEIGHT: bold; 
}

.TableHead{
BACKGROUND-COLOR: #CCCCCC;
FONT-WEIGHT: bold;
font-size:1em;
}

.TableSubHead
{
 BACKGROUND-COLOR: #EEEEEE;
font-size:.8em;
}
